Dothan Police Looking For Theft Suspect

By: Stephen Crews
Updated: August 6, 2012

The Dothan Police Department is seeking the help of our local community in locating a woman who is wanted for receiving stolen property.

Investigators say an investigation has led them to a local used sports shop where they recovered multiple stolen items which were sold to the business by Kristi English.

Police are asking anyone with information about the case or location of the suspect to call the Dothan Police Department or CrimeStoppers 334-793-7000.


     Kristi English, white female, 42 years of age, of Headland Avenue is WANTED for Second Degree Receiving Stolen Property.
